What Makes a Casino Trustworthy?
Trust is built from several visible details. A reputable operator normally identifies its legal company, regulatory authority, licence information, customer-support channels, and data-protection practices. These details should be easy to locate, not buried behind vague wording or inaccessible pages.
Players should also confirm whether the casino is permitted to serve their location. Gambling laws differ between jurisdictions, and a platform that is legitimate in one market may not be authorised in another. Checking local eligibility before registering can prevent withdrawal problems later.
- Look for a recognised gambling licence and verifiable company details.
- Read the terms for deposits, withdrawals, bonuses, and account closure.
- Check whether identity verification is explained clearly.
- Confirm that support is available through practical contact methods.
- Review responsible-gambling limits before making a deposit.
Games, Software, and Fairness
Game selection matters, but quantity should not be confused with quality. A casino may list thousands of titles while offering limited variety or games from unknown suppliers. Stronger platforms usually combine established studios with transparent information about return to player rates, volatility, and game rules.
Players interested in slots can compare themes, mechanics, progressive jackpots, and feature frequency. Table-game fans may prefer casinos with live dealer rooms, multiple stake ranges, and clearly displayed betting limits. Sports bettors should examine market coverage, settlement rules, and the availability of cash-out features rather than judging a site solely by its interface.
| Area to check | Why it matters | Useful question |
|---|---|---|
| Software providers | Indicates game origin and technical credibility | Are recognised studios represented? |
| RTP information | Shows the theoretical long-term return of a game | Is the figure displayed before play? |
| Live casino | Combines streaming with real-time dealer play | Are tables and limits suitable for your budget? |
| Mobile performance | Influences usability on smaller screens | Can games and banking tools work smoothly? |
Bonuses: Read the Mathematics
Promotions can add value, but their headline amount rarely tells the whole story. A bonus may include a minimum deposit, a maximum qualifying amount, a wagering multiplier, restricted games, a time limit, and a maximum cash-out. Each condition affects the real usefulness of the offer.
For example, a deposit match with a 35-times wagering requirement can demand considerable play before any bonus balance becomes withdrawable. Some casinos also apply different contribution rates: slots may count fully, while roulette, blackjack, or live games may contribute little or nothing. Read the complete promotion page before accepting an offer.
Questions to ask before claiming
- How much must be deposited to qualify?
- What is the exact wagering requirement?
- Which games contribute, and at what percentage?
- Is there a deadline for completing the conditions?
- What happens if the player withdraws before completion?
Banking Speed and Account Verification
Payment choice can influence the entire casino experience. Card deposits are often immediate, while bank transfers may take longer. E-wallets can provide convenience, but availability, fees, and withdrawal limits vary by country. A casino should display processing times clearly instead of promising instant transactions without qualification.
Verification is another normal part of regulated gambling. Operators may request identity, address, and payment-source documents to meet anti-money-laundering requirements. This process should be completed through secure channels. Players should never send sensitive documents through an unverified contact or ignore a request until the account is locked.
Responsible Play as a Selection Criterion
Responsible gambling features are not decorative additions; they are practical safeguards. Before playing, consider whether the casino offers deposit limits, loss limits, session reminders, time-outs, self-exclusion, and access to independent support organisations. A well-designed platform makes these controls visible and straightforward to activate.
Set a budget that represents entertainment spending, not essential income. Avoid chasing losses, increasing stakes after a difficult session, or borrowing money to continue playing. If gambling stops feeling recreational, pause immediately and seek professional support.
